Overview of the chroma key effects

Overview of the chroma key effects

You can use the Matrox realtime plug-in to apply a chroma key or chroma key
shadow effect to make certain areas of a foreground image transparent based on a
color in that image, so that an underlying image can show through.

In the following example of a chroma key effect, our foreground image is a video
clip of a woman sitting in front of a green backdrop, and our underlying image is
a video clip of a sand dune:

By chroma keying on the particular shade of green in the backdrop of the
foreground image, the backdrop area becomes transparent and the corresponding
area of the underlying image shows through in the composite image as follows:

¡ Important

The chroma key shadow effect includes controls for fine-tuning

shadows in your effect. It is best to use the chroma key shadow effect when you
are performing a chroma key without any additional effects. If you want to apply
additional effects to your chroma key, you will get more desirable results by
using the chroma key effect without shadow controls. For example, if you want to
apply a DVE to your chroma key, you should use the chroma key effect and not
the chroma key shadow effect.
